Location & Access:

Duffey Lake Backcountry zone is located just east of Pemberton, a short drive north of Whistler. The various ski areas in the Duffey lake zone are all accessed right off the side of highway 99. No need for a 4x4 or snowmobile!

Heli-Access:

There are a number of amazing ski areas in the Duffy that are just too far to get to in a reasonable day. That's where the heli-access option really shines. We catch a helicopter lift up in the am and start skiing in zones very seldom visited. Then, after we've had a few amazing laps, we ski down to a car that we've staged on the Duffey Lake road. This option is only available on private trips.
